Day One:  Portland
  • Meet and greet 1:00 p.m. at our host hotel (changes by seasons)
  • Lunch at a local hot spot, with complimentary cook books from the chef
  • Afternoon on own to explore Portland, check out the major attractions, or rest up for first dinner event
  • Dinner at a local restaurant, with wine pairing and getting acquainted with our new friends
Day Two: Portland
  • Morning walking Epicurean Tour of Portland and the Pearl District
  • Lunch at Jakes of Portland, this is a quick lunch as we are off to the Chef's Studio
  • Afternoon class with dinner at Chef Robert Reynolds Chef's Studio, you will work for dinner!
Day Three:  Portland to Seattle
  • Depart in the morning for a wonderful train journey northbound, lunch on-board
  • Afternoon on own to settle into our hotel or walk about the downtown area
  • Dinner at a special Bistro, chef's menu with wonderful local wine pairings - artistry at its' best
Day Four: Seattle
  • Market Tour and cooking class with lunch and a nice wine
  • Wine tasting event before going off to dinner
  • Dinner at a wonderful small restaurant, where you will meet your chef - his choice for dinner
  • Evening on your own
Day Five: Seattle to Victoria, B.C.
  • Morning departure to Victoria, along our waterways - spectacular journey
  • Lunch at the oldest brew pub in Victoria, with ale pairing and cheese tasting
  • Afternoon High Tea at the Fairmont, a tradition we never miss
  • Dinner tonight will blow you away, at one of Victoria's newest sister spot to our favorite bistro
Day Six: Victoria, B.C.
  • A private tour of three wineries, cheese producer, cider house with lunch
  • City tour upon your return or afternoon on your own
  • Once again, a French bistro comes into play, with only 45 seats and 4 months advance reservations needed
  • Walking back to our hotel, you may want to wonder off for a night cap or take in the local talent
Day Seven: Victoria, B.C. to Vancouver B.C.
  • Morning shopping and lunch at a cute Italian Eatery
  • Afternoon departure with a stop at Butchard Gardens
  • Then a trip over the water ways to Vancouver, this is so spectacular you must have your camera ready!
  • Late night arrival in Vancouver, dinner at a chef's hand our - Japanese Food at its best
Day Eight: Vancouver, B.C.
  • The best tour of Granville Island hands down, by Edible-British Columbia, these people know their stuff
  • Stops and tastings at the best vendors, shop at Edible-British Columbia shop and gift bags along the way
  • Private afternoon tour of Vancouver, your the only passengers on this tour in a great van, with a great guide
  • Dinner tonight hosted by Edible British Columbia, at the Metro, you can't miss this new conceptual spot
Day Nine: Vancouver, B.C. to Seattle, WA.
  • Late morning departure via Bus or Private Vehicle depending on group size with arrival in Seattle, this will end
    your journey as we drop you off at your hotel of choice (post stay) or the Seattle-Tacoma Airport for your safe
    return home.
